Yaju Li is a scholar working on Mechanics of Materials, Atmospheric Science and Global and Planetary Change. According to data from OpenAlex, Yaju Li has authored 19 papers receiving a total of 303 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 5 papers in Mechanics of Materials, 4 papers in Atmospheric Science and 4 papers in Global and Planetary Change. Recurrent topics in Yaju Li's work include Laser-induced spectroscopy and plasma (5 papers), Analytical chemistry methods development (3 papers) and Climate variability and models (3 papers). Yaju Li is often cited by papers focused on Laser-induced spectroscopy and plasma (5 papers), Analytical chemistry methods development (3 papers) and Climate variability and models (3 papers). Yaju Li collaborates with scholars based in China, Taiwan and United States. Yaju Li's co-authors include Shengjie Wang, Mingjun Zhang, Ji‐Kai Liu, Fei Wang, Zhongqin Li, Feiteng Wang, Xiaoyan Huang, Fu‐Cai Ren, Huilin Li and Fei Wang and has published in prestigious journals such as Clinica Chimica Acta, Journal of Natural Products and Journal of Geophysical Research Atmospheres.
